After the matrix is installed and then the xbox is booted up should you see the orginal xbox dashboard or the one installed on the matrix or what?

The Matrix itself does not have a dash on it, just a ROM.

If you want to use another dash (eg EvolutionX) then you need to put this on a CD-R/W or install it to the HDD.
